Susan Minot is an award-winning novelist, short-story writer, poet, and screenwriter. Her new novel, “Don't Be a Stranger,” centers on the relationship between a younger man and an older single mother. It is a story about erotic obsession, the hunger for intimacy, communication, and oblivion.
